What Is Insulin Resistance?

Insulin is a hormone your pancreas releases after you eat, and its job is to help move glucose (sugar) from your bloodstream into your cells, where it's used for energy. Insulin resistance occurs when your cells stop responding properly to that signal. Your pancreas compensates by producing more and more insulin, but over time, blood sugar levels can still begin to creep upward. Left unaddressed, insulin resistance can progress into prediabetes and eventually type 2 diabetes.

What makes insulin resistance especially tricky is that many people don't know they have it until it has already progressed. There may be no obvious symptoms in the early stages, which is why proactive dietary habits matter so much. The encouraging news is that lifestyle changes — particularly around food — can meaningfully improve insulin sensitivity and, in many cases, help reverse the condition before it advances further.

How Diet Affects Insulin Sensitivity

Not all foods place the same demand on your insulin system. Foods high in refined carbohydrates and added sugars digest quickly, flooding the bloodstream with glucose and triggering a sharp spike in insulin. When this happens repeatedly over years, your cells can become desensitized to insulin's signal — a core driver of insulin resistance. Saturated fats compound the problem by promoting low-grade inflammation, which research has identified as another key factor in the development of insulin resistance.

On the other side of the equation, foods that are rich in fiber, healthy fats, and quality protein slow digestion, smooth out blood sugar responses, and reduce the overall demand placed on your pancreas. Chronically elevated blood sugar isn't just about carbohydrates in isolation — it's about meal composition, food quality, and overall eating patterns. Understanding this helps explain why a whole-food, balanced approach consistently outperforms any single "superfood" or quick fix.

Best Foods to Eat for Insulin Resistance

Non-Starchy Vegetables

Non-starchy vegetables are among the most valuable foods you can eat when managing insulin resistance. They're low in calories, high in fiber, and loaded with antioxidants and polyphenols that help combat the inflammation linked to poor insulin signaling. Dark leafy greens like spinach, kale, and collards are especially beneficial, as are cruciferous vegetables like broccoli, cauliflower, and Brussels sprouts. Colorful options — red and yellow peppers, tomatoes, carrots — offer carotenoids and other plant compounds that support metabolic health. Aim to make non-starchy vegetables the foundation of every meal, filling at least half your plate.

When choosing vegetables, fresh or frozen options are generally your best bet. If using canned varieties, look for low-sodium options with no added sugars. One note of caution: starchy vegetables like potatoes, corn, and peas behave more like grains in terms of their effect on blood sugar, so it's wise to treat them as a carbohydrate portion rather than as a free vegetable.

High-Fiber Fruits

Fruit offers vitamins, minerals, antioxidants, and fiber — all beneficial when you're managing insulin resistance. The key is choosing whole fruits rather than juices, and favoring those with a lower glycemic load. Berries (blueberries, strawberries, raspberries), apples, pears, peaches, and green bananas are solid choices because their fiber content slows the absorption of natural sugars, reducing blood sugar spikes. Higher glycemic fruits like watermelon and pineapple are best enjoyed in smaller portions. Fruit juice — even unsweetened varieties — removes much of the fiber and can raise blood sugar almost as quickly as a sugary soft drink, so it's best avoided.

Whole Grains

Whole grains are a smart carbohydrate choice for people with insulin resistance because their fiber content slows digestion and blunts blood sugar spikes — a process that reduces pressure on the pancreas. Foods like oatmeal, brown rice, quinoa, whole-wheat bread, bulgur, barley, and farro qualify as whole-grain options. The critical distinction is processing: when grains are refined into white flour or white rice, the fibrous outer layers are stripped away, leaving behind a starchy core that digests rapidly. When choosing packaged products, look for "whole grain" or "whole wheat" as the first ingredient on the label. Eating grains as part of a mixed meal — alongside protein and healthy fat — further moderates the blood sugar response.

Beans and Legumes

Beans and legumes are one of the most underrated foods for blood sugar management. They're rich in both soluble fiber and plant-based protein, and they have a naturally low glycemic index — meaning they raise blood sugar slowly and steadily. Black beans, pinto beans, lentils, chickpeas, kidney beans, and soybeans all fit beautifully into an insulin resistance diet. Research has consistently shown that regular legume consumption is linked to better insulin sensitivity and reduced risk of type 2 diabetes. They're also highly versatile: toss them into soups and stews, blend them into dips, or use them as a main protein source in place of meat.

Fatty Fish and Lean Proteins

Omega-3-rich fish like salmon, mackerel, sardines, herring, and trout are excellent for people managing insulin resistance, partly because omega-3 fatty acids help reduce the chronic inflammation that underlies poor insulin signaling. Beyond fish, lean protein sources — including chicken breast, turkey, eggs, tofu, and tempeh — help stabilize blood sugar by slowing glucose absorption and reducing overall insulin demand after meals. For those following a vegetarian or plant-based approach, soy products and legumes offer a strong protein foundation without the saturated fat concerns associated with fatty cuts of meat.

Healthy Fats

Not all fats are created equal when it comes to insulin sensitivity. Unsaturated fats — found in olive oil, avocados, nuts, seeds, and fatty fish — are associated with better insulin response, while saturated fats found in full-fat animal products and fried foods have been linked to worsening insulin resistance. Swapping butter for olive oil, adding a handful of walnuts or almonds to meals, or incorporating avocado into salads are simple, practical ways to shift your fat intake in a more beneficial direction. Nuts and seeds also provide magnesium, a mineral many people with insulin resistance are deficient in. Just be mindful of portions — healthy fats are calorie-dense, and overconsumption can work against weight management goals.

Foods to Limit or Avoid

Just as important as knowing what to eat is understanding what to pull back on. The following foods are the biggest dietary contributors to worsening insulin resistance:

  • Sugary beverages — Sodas, fruit juices, energy drinks, and sweetened coffees deliver large doses of sugar directly into the bloodstream with no fiber to slow absorption. Liquid fructose in particular has been identified as a contributor to liver-based insulin resistance.
  • Refined carbohydrates — White bread, white rice, regular pasta, most breakfast cereals, and crackers are low in fiber and cause rapid blood sugar spikes that drive insulin demand.
  • Ultra-processed and packaged snack foods — These products often combine refined starch, added sugar, excess unhealthy fats, and additives in a format engineered for overconsumption. Research has pointed to ultra-processed foods as direct contributors to obesity and worsening insulin resistance.
  • Saturated and trans fats — Fried foods, full-fat processed meats, pastries made with hydrogenated oils, and excessive cheese can build insulin resistance over time and contribute to the development of type 2 diabetes.
  • Alcohol (in excess) — Moderate alcohol may have mixed evidence, but heavy drinking impairs the liver's ability to regulate blood sugar and promotes the accumulation of visceral fat, both of which worsen insulin sensitivity.
  • Sweetened condiments and sauces — Ketchup, barbecue sauce, teriyaki sauce, and many salad dressings can contain surprising amounts of added sugar, quietly adding up over the course of a day.

The key is not perfection but consistency. Occasionally having these foods as part of an otherwise balanced diet is very different from eating them daily. The goal is to make the insulin-friendly choices your default, not a rigid rule.

Best Dietary Patterns: Mediterranean vs. Low-Carb

Individual foods matter, but overall dietary patterns have an even bigger impact on insulin sensitivity over time. Two eating frameworks consistently stand out in the research: the Mediterranean diet and low-carbohydrate diets.

The Mediterranean diet is among the most thoroughly researched eating patterns in the world. It emphasizes vegetables, fruits, whole grains, legumes, nuts, seeds, and olive oil, with moderate amounts of fish and low to moderate intake of poultry and dairy. Studies have found that following a Mediterranean dietary pattern is associated with lower markers of insulin resistance, improved HbA1c levels, and a reduced risk of type 2 diabetes. One mechanism driving these benefits is the diet's naturally anti-inflammatory profile — rich in polyphenols, antioxidants, and omega-3 fatty acids. Its emphasis on whole, minimally processed foods and healthy fats makes it both metabolically supportive and sustainable for most people long-term.

Low-carbohydrate diets take a different approach, prioritizing fat and protein while significantly reducing carbohydrate intake. They can deliver faster short-term results for weight loss and blood sugar reduction, particularly for those with more advanced insulin resistance. Clinical research has shown that both Mediterranean and low-carbohydrate diets can similarly improve insulin resistance and fasting insulin levels, though the low-carb approach may be less nutritionally diverse and harder to maintain long-term for many people. The Mediterranean diet's emphasis on fiber-rich carbohydrates from legumes and vegetables also provides gut health benefits that very low-carb approaches may miss.

In practice, the best diet for insulin resistance is one you can actually sustain. A Mediterranean-inspired eating pattern that is naturally lower in refined carbohydrates offers the best of both worlds — strong metabolic benefits alongside variety, flavor, and long-term adherence.

The Plate Method: A Practical Starting Point

If building a blood-sugar-friendly meal feels complicated, the plate method simplifies it beautifully. The idea is straightforward: at each meal, fill half your plate with non-starchy vegetables (spinach, broccoli, salad greens), dedicate one quarter to lean protein (fish, chicken, tofu, legumes), and reserve the remaining quarter for high-fiber carbohydrates (brown rice, quinoa, sweet potato, or whole-grain bread). Add a small serving of healthy fat — a drizzle of olive oil, a few slices of avocado, or a small handful of nuts — and make water your primary beverage throughout the day.

This approach naturally limits refined carbohydrates without requiring calorie counting, creates balanced meals that slow glucose absorption, and ensures you're getting adequate fiber and protein with every sitting. It's flexible enough to adapt to any cuisine and practical enough to use at restaurants and social occasions. Starting with this framework alone, even before making any other changes, can make a meaningful difference in how your body manages blood sugar over the course of a week.

Psyllium seed fiber: Psyllium is a well-studied soluble fiber with meaningful evidence for its effect on blood sugar. Clinical research has shown that psyllium can significantly lower postprandial (after-meal) glucose and insulin concentrations, and a published meta-analysis found it reduced peak postprandial blood glucose by a significant margin. Its soluble fiber forms a gel-like substance in the digestive tract that slows carbohydrate absorption, effectively blunting the blood sugar spike that follows a meal. Lifestyle Tips Beyond the Plate

Diet is central to improving insulin sensitivity, but it doesn't operate in isolation. Several complementary lifestyle habits can amplify your results significantly:

  • Move regularly. Physical activity makes your cells more sensitive to insulin and helps lower blood sugar levels directly. You don't need an intense gym program — consistent daily walking, swimming, cycling, or even gardening adds up. New guidelines suggest breaking up long periods of sitting every 30 minutes with brief movement.
  • Manage your weight. Even modest weight loss — as little as 5 to 7 percent of your body weight — can meaningfully reduce the risk of progressing from insulin resistance to type 2 diabetes. Weight loss works synergistically with dietary change, and the two together are far more effective than either alone.
  • Prioritize sleep. Poor sleep quality is a surprisingly potent driver of insulin resistance. Even one or two nights of disrupted sleep can measurably impair glucose metabolism. Establishing a consistent sleep routine and addressing factors that interrupt nighttime rest can have real benefits for blood sugar health.
  • Reduce chronic stress. Stress hormones like cortisol raise blood sugar levels and can work against insulin sensitivity over time. Practices like mindful breathing, gentle movement, and time spent in nature can help regulate the stress response.
  • Get tested early. Many people don't know they have insulin resistance until it progresses further. Asking your doctor to check your fasting insulin, fasting glucose, and hemoglobin A1c levels can give you an early window into your metabolic health — and the earlier you catch it, the more room you have to course-correct.
